Change Time On Your Amazon Echo In The Alexa App
To change time on your Amazon Echo, here is what you need to do.
- Open the Alexa app and go to Devices. Filter by Device Type if you have several devices other than Alexa.

- Select the device you want to change and tap the Settings icon in the top right corner. In the Device Settings, scroll until you find the device Time Zone option.

- Select the Region if needed, followed by Country and Time Zone.

By updating the time zone and ensuring the correct address is registered, my Echo accurately reflects local time, including daylight saving changes.
Adjusting Clock Display Settings on Echo Dot with Clock
Inside my device’s settings, I can customize the clock display. Using an on-screen toggle, I can switch between a 12-hour and a 24-hour clock. If my Echo has a screen, I can adjust display brightness, which is especially handy at night or in dim environments.
How To Change The Time On An Amazon Echo Show
When setting the time on an Amazon Echo Show, you have two simple options: using the device’s display directly or adjusting the settings in the Alexa app.
This time, let me walk you through the first method.
- On your Amazon Echo Show device, swipe from the top to open the menu and tap Settings.

- In Settings, scroll down until you find Device Options and click on it.

- Inside Device Options, find and tap Date & Time.

- Select the desired Region and Time Zone. The change should happen almost instantly.

While doing this on the device itself is possible, customizing your Echo Show’s settings via the Alexa app allows you to update the device even when you’re not near the device location. This is especially useful if you have multiple Echo Show devices across different time zones, such as the Echo Show 5 or Echo Show 15.
Frequently Asked Questions
How can I adjust the displayed time on an Echo Dot with a clock?
To alter the time display on an Echo Dot with a clock, ask Alexa to change to a 12-hour or 24-hour format. If preferred, open the Alexa app, choose ‘Devices,’ select your Echo Dot, and adjust the settings in the device options.
What is the procedure for customizing the clock face on my Alexa device?
Customizing the clock face on Alexa devices is typically a feature available on specific models with a screen, such as the Echo Show. In the device settings within the Alexa app, I can select options to personalize the clock face, choosing different styles or backgrounds.
What should I do to reset the time on my Amazon Echo device?
To reset the time on my Amazon Echo, I ensure it’s connected to a stable Wi-Fi network, as it usually syncs time-based on the internet connection. If it displays the wrong time, I check the device settings in the Alexa app for the correct time zone configuration and make the necessary adjustments.
